| Index: third_party/WebKit/LayoutTests/inspector/tracing/timeline-time/timeline-timer.html
|
| diff --git a/third_party/WebKit/LayoutTests/inspector/tracing/timeline-time/timeline-timer.html b/third_party/WebKit/LayoutTests/inspector/tracing/timeline-time/timeline-timer.html
|
| index beaed25dfbef38ae00ba89293387efbac8d796f1..4b6370c5b69ce176f40a354d1d40dd5aa7451a71 100644
|
| --- a/third_party/WebKit/LayoutTests/inspector/tracing/timeline-time/timeline-timer.html
|
| +++ b/third_party/WebKit/LayoutTests/inspector/tracing/timeline-time/timeline-timer.html
|
| @@ -4,8 +4,10 @@
|
| <script src="../../../http/tests/inspector/timeline-test.js"></script>
|
| <script>
|
|
|
| -function performActions(callback)
|
| +function performActions()
|
| {
|
| + var callback;
|
| + var promise = new Promise((fulfill) => callback = fulfill);
|
| var timerOne = setTimeout("1 + 1", 10);
|
| var timerTwo = setInterval(intervalTimerWork, 20);
|
| var iteration = 0;
|
| @@ -17,6 +19,7 @@ function performActions(callback)
|
| clearInterval(timerTwo);
|
| callback();
|
| }
|
| + return promise;
|
| }
|
|
|
| function test()
|
|
|